This subject provides an opportunity for students to extend and make more sophisticated their understanding of professional and practitioner influence on health care policy and explore in detail the leadership aspects of changing and extending professional practice. There is an expectation that students situate their own practice issues within the context of relevant state and national policy and explore the international influences that impact on local workplaces. The subject examines factors that bear on resistance to and facilitation of change within professional practice. It provides a community of scholars with whom to discuss implications of plans for change and to discuss the leadership aspects of resolving practice and health care policy problems.
